The first wax that also works at low temperatures.
At low temperatures, wax becomes very hard resulting in the chain coming off quickly. Last weekend I tested it at -3 on the mtb and it remained smooth. The biggest advantage of wax over oil is that you need to polish much less and the chain and cassette last much longer. Do degrease the chain very well the first time.

Not really as useful as the classic version
Unlike the classic version, the low-temperature version is much thicker. As a result, you lose some of the advantages of wax... The lubricant makes sticky clumps and the chain is harder to clean because the dirt sticks to the chain more. It's still not as bad as conventional lubricants. I bought this product to see... I can't see any real benefit over the classic version, except perhaps that it's more resistant to bad weather.
